Multi-platform omics analysis of Nipah virus infection reveals viral glycoprotein modulation of mitochondria
Summary: The recent global pandemic illustrates the importance of understanding the host cellular infection processes of emerging zoonotic viruses. Nipah virus (NiV) is a deadly zoonotic biosafety level 4 encephalitic and respiratory paramyxovirus. Our knowledge of the molecular cell biology of NiV...
